20090020294 | Well Access Line Positioning Assembly - An assembly for positioning a well access line in a well. The assembly is located between a supply of well access line and a well, with the line running through the assembly and to the well. Multiple pulleys are incorporated into the assembly about which a well access line such as a conventional wireline may be wrapped. The pulleys are biased to one another such that slack in the line may be stored at the assembly and drawn on in the event of line tension spiking up to a predetermined amount. As such, tension in the line may be kept to a minimum so as to avoid damage to the line during a well access operation. Furthermore, should the tension in the line fail to come back down to below the predetermined amount, the well access operation may be halted in an automated manner. Halting may proceed while continuing to allow take-up of the slack in the line until completed halting of the operation is achieved. | 01-22-2009 |

20090194296 | Extended Length Cable Assembly for a Hydrocarbon Well Application - A cable assembly for use in a hydrocarbon well of extensive depth. The cable assembly may be effectively employed at well depths of over 30,000 feet. Indeed, embodiments of the assembly may be effectively employed at depths of over 50,000 feet while powering and directing downhole equipment at a downhole end thereof The assembly may be made up of a comparatively high break strength uphole cable portion coupled to a lighter downhole cable portion. This configuration helps to ensure the structural integrity of the assembly in light of its own load when disposed in a well to such extensive depths. Additionally, the assembly may be employed at such depths with an intervening connector sub having a signal amplification mechanism incorporated therein to alleviate concern over telemetry between the surface of the oilfield and the downhole equipment. | 08-06-2009 |

20140158379 | Systems and Methods for Cable Deployment of Downhole Equipment - Systems and methods for cable deployment of downhole equipment, wherein the conductors of a power cable bear the load of the downhole equipment and jewelry, as well as the cable itself. The power cable includes a set of elongated conductors, an upper coupling and a lower coupling. The upper support coupling suspends each of the conductors from the support structure and electrically couples the conductors to a power source. The lower coupling suspends the downhole electrical equipment from the conductors and electrically couples the conductors to the downhole equipment. One embodiment uses 7075 T-6 aluminum conductors to provide a length of at least 10,000 feet, a yield stress of at least 50,000 psi and a resistance of less than 0.2 ohm/kf. The aluminum conductors are homogeneous and are non-reactive with hydrogen sulfide, so no lead sheathing is required. | 06-12-2014 |
